.status[data-v-b0b231e8]{font-weight:700;text-transform:none!important;color:#fff}.appbar_tabs_btn[data-v-d16e93ee]{display:-webkit-box;display:-ms-flexbox;display:flex;width:100%}.appbar[data-v-d16e93ee]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-direction:row;flex-direction:row;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between}.appbar__btn[data-v-d16e93ee]{margin:0}.appbar__filter[data-v-d16e93ee]{width:100%;max-width:400px;margin-left:10px}.appbar__status[data-v-d16e93ee]{width:100%;max-width:300px}@media(max-width:540px){.appbar[data-v-d16e93ee]{-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column}.appbar__btn[data-v-d16e93ee]{width:100%;margin-bottom:15px}.appbar__status[data-v-d16e93ee]{margin-bottom:15px}.appbar__filter[data-v-d16e93ee],.appbar__status[data-v-d16e93ee]{max-width:inherit;margin-left:0}}.v-list-item__title[data-v-d16e93ee]{cursor:pointer}[data-v-d16e93ee] .rsvp-status.paid .v-chip__content{color:#05690d!important}[data-v-d16e93ee] .rsvp-status.unpaid .v-chip__content{color:#545969!important}[data-v-d16e93ee] .custom-event-wrapper{display:-webkit-box;display:-ms-flexbox;display:flex;gap:4px;-webkit-box-align:center;-ms-flex-align:center;align-items:center}[data-v-d16e93ee] .custom-event{-webkit-box-flex:1;-ms-flex:1;flex:1;border-radius:8px;display:-webkit-box;display:-ms-flexbox;display:flex;gap:10px;overflow:hidden;text-overflow:ellipsis;white-space:nowrap}[data-v-d16e93ee] .dot{min-width:8px;width:8px;height:8px;border-radius:6px;background-color:#0085ff}[data-v-d16e93ee] .fc-h-event{background-color:inherit;border:none}[data-v-d16e93ee] #booking-list .fc-day,[data-v-d16e93ee] #booking-list .fc-daygrid-day{min-width:160px;-webkit-box-sizing:border-box;box-sizing:border-box}[data-v-d16e93ee] #booking-list .fc-scrollgrid{overflow-x:auto}[data-v-d16e93ee] #booking-list .fc.fc-media-screen.fc-direction-ltr.fc-theme-standard .fc-header-toolbar.fc-toolbar{-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;margin-bottom:2rem}[data-v-d16e93ee] #booking-list .fc.fc-media-screen.fc-direction-ltr.fc-theme-standard .fc-header-toolbar.fc-toolbar .fc-prev-button{background:transparent;border:none;color:#000;margin-right:2rem;padding-top:0}[data-v-d16e93ee] #booking-list .fc.fc-media-screen.fc-direction-ltr.fc-theme-standard .fc-header-toolbar.fc-toolbar .fc-next-button{background:transparent;border:none;color:#000;margin-left:2rem;padding-top:0}[data-v-d16e93ee] #booking-list .fc-direction-ltr a.fc-daygrid-more-link{float:right!important}[data-v-d16e93ee] #booking-list .fc-daygrid-day-frame .fc-daygrid-day-top{-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}[data-v-d16e93ee] #booking-list .fc-day-other{background:#eee;border-color:#e0e0e0}[data-v-d16e93ee] #booking-list .fc-daygrid-day-number{font-weight:600}[data-v-d16e93ee] #booking-list .fc-toolbar-title{font-size:1.25rem;text-transform:uppercase}[data-v-d16e93ee] #booking-list .fc-day.fc-popover{height:-webkit-fit-content;height:-moz-fit-content;height:fit-content}[data-v-d16e93ee] #booking-list .fc-day.fc-popover .fc-daygrid-event-harness a,[data-v-d16e93ee] #booking-list .fc-day.fc-popover .fc-popover-title{font-size:1rem}[data-v-d16e93ee] #booking-list .fc-day .fc-event-main{padding:0 5px}[data-v-d16e93ee] #booking-list .fc-daygrid-day{position:relative;min-width:160px;-webkit-box-sizing:border-box;box-sizing:border-box}[data-v-d16e93ee] #booking-list .fc-daygrid-event-harness{width:100%;display:block}[data-v-d16e93ee] #booking-list .custom-event{width:90%!important;-webkit-box-sizing:border-box;box-sizing:border-box;display:-webkit-box;display:-ms-flexbox;display:flex;gap:10px;border-radius:8px;overflow:hidden}[data-v-d16e93ee] #booking-list .booking-info{width:95%!important;overflow:hidden;text-overflow:ellipsis;white-space:nowrap;display:block}[data-v-d16e93ee] #booking-list .booking-info p{margin-bottom:0}[data-v-d16e93ee] #booking-list .fc .fc-daygrid-day-bottom{min-height:22px}[data-v-d16e93ee] #booking-list .fc .fc-daygrid-body-natural .fc-daygrid-day-events{margin-bottom:0}[data-v-d16e93ee] #booking-list .fc-popover-body{max-height:320px;overflow:scroll}[data-v-d16e93ee] #booking-list .fc .fc-daygrid-day-frame{min-height:120px}[data-v-d16e93ee] #booking-list .fc .fc-day{height:120px}[data-v-d16e93ee] #booking-list .fc-day.fc-col-header-cell{height:40px}